- About NCF
- Blogs
- Forums
- International Media Council
- Introduction to the International Media Awards
- 2005 Media Awards
- 2006 Media Awards
- 2007 Media Awards
- 2008 Media Awards
- 2009 Media Awards
- 2010 Media Awards
- 2011 Media Awards
- Full List of International Media Awards winners, 2005-2011
- Media Credibility Index 2011
- Photos from the 2011 Media Awards Dinner
- The International Media Awards 2012: Nominations Shortlist
- Membership
- NCF People
- Reports
- Working Groups
- Donate
- Create content
- Info (NCF team only)
Help
Distributed authentication
One of the more tedious moments in visiting a new website is filling out the registration form. Here at The Next Century Foundation, you do not have to fill out a registration form if you are already a member of Drupal. This capability is called distributed authentication, and Drupal, the software which powers The Next Century Foundation, fully supports it.
Distributed authentication enables a new user to input a username and password into the login box, and immediately be recognized, even if that user never registered at The Next Century Foundation. This works because Drupal knows how to communicate with external registration databases. For example, lets say that new user 'Joe' is already a registered member of Delphi Forums. Drupal informs Joe on registration and login screens that he may login with his Delphi ID instead of registering with The Next Century Foundation. Joe likes that idea, and logs in with a username of joe@remote.delphiforums.com and his usual Delphi password. Drupal then contacts the remote.delphiforums.com server behind the scenes (usually using XML-RPC, HTTP POST, or SOAP) and asks: "Is the password for user Joe correct?". If Delphi replies yes, then we create a new The Next Century Foundation account for Joe and log him into it. Joe may keep on logging into The Next Century Foundation in the same manner, and he will always be logged into the same account.

